このユーザー入力の数学関数 (index.py) はコマンド ラインで動作し、それと app.yaml ファイルが GAE にアップロードされ、GAE からデプロイされたことを確認しますが、内部サーバー 500 エラーが発生します。これらの print ステートメントは HTML なしで提供できますか?それがサーバー エラーの原因でしょうか?
#!/usr/bin/env python
import cgi
import math
print "Content-type: text/html"
exp = input('Enter base and exponent, separated by comma.\n')
print '= %d \n' % math.pow(*exp)
app.yaml
application: python-math
version: 1
runtime: python27
api_version: 1
threadsafe: false
handlers:
-url: /stylesheets/
static_dir: stylesheets
-url: /.*
script: index.py